It might have only 75K on it, but they must've been hard miles. Both a repaint and a carpet replacement were done already. No doubt it's a very-pretty car--the non-original wheels do look good here--but a '66 300 without the 365HP 440 is just a New Yorker with a fancy grille. Halve the price and you're maybe a little low, but at least in the right price range. During the peak years of musclecar pricing, EFI Ed bought a 38,000-mile example with the 365-horse tall-deck, buckets & console w/tach, and full power goodies including Budd 4-piston front discs. It was 100% original except for the tires, in white with a black vinyl roof and interior. He paid $3,800 for it, and I don't think he's put another 10K on it in almost 19 years.
